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port (DCA)
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port is located in Arlington, Virginia, just 8 kilometres from downtown Washington, D.C. It primarily serves domestic flights, though some international routes operate from here. Its proximity to the city makes it a convenient choice for direct access to many central areas. The airport is well-connected to the Metrorail system.
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D)
Washington Dulles International Airport, situated about 42 kilometres west of downtown Washington, D.C. in Sterling, Virginia, serves as a major hub for international and long-haul domestic flights. It offers extensive connections globally, making it a key entry point for many travellers. The Silver Line Metro provides direct service to the airport.
Baltimore/Washington International Thurgood Marshall Airport (BWI)
Baltimore/Washington International Thurgood Marshall Airport is located 50 kilometres north of Washington, D.C., near Baltimore, Maryland. This airport offers a wide range of domestic and international flights, often providing competitive fares. It is accessible from Washington, D.C. via Amtrak and MARC train services, with shuttle connections to the airport terminal.
